Dos Coyotes Border Cafe
3191 Crow Canyon Pl Suite L
San Ramon, California
San Ramon, California
Closed : 11:30 AM - 8:00 PM
Tabla Indian Restaurant - San Mateo
450 S Norfolk St
San Mateo, California
San Mateo, California
Closed : 11:30 AM - 9:00 PM
Mr. Pickle's Sandwich Shop
3141 Crow Canyon Pl Suite F - 2
San Ramon, California
San Ramon, California
Open : 10:00 AM - 6:00 PM